As I see it, from a businessman stand point, state laws are more the root of the problem than any. To be a professional anything, states issue a business licenses; I.E. - Accountant, Lawyer....

Most all states have laws against being in the business of betting / wagering, though they allow you tom do the activity (48 have some form of gambling).

The lack of issuing individuals a 'license' to be in the professional gaming / wagering business in many ways adds to the IRS position.
